Can Damage Your Pipes Further
When encountering a clogged pipe, many homeowners opt to use liquid drain cleaners. Unfortunately, this often proves to be a big mistake. These products are typically designed to break down gunk using heat. Temperatures can become hot enough to melt plastic pipes from the inside out. The toxic chemicals can also cause metal to corrode. It Can Be Dangerous
When dealing with liquid drain cleaners, you must be extremely careful. The powerful fumes can cause respiratory problems. Even worse, the chemicals put you at risk of suffering chemical burns. Instead of jeopardizing your health, choose professional drain cleaning in West Chester, PA.
